Urgent Problems to Watch for in Diesel Trucks
Regardless of routine maintenance, diesel trucks may develop issues that require quick expert intervention. One of the most serious concerns centers on the fuel system—in which blocked fuel filters, faulty injectors, or dirty diesel often lead to power loss, rough idle, or complete engine failure. Swift professional assessment is crucial to avoid additional engine damage and extended service interruptions. An equally important problem needing quick attention is engine overheating. Insufficient cooling fluid, malfunctioning temperature controls, or failing cooling systems may lead to dangerous heat levels. Ignoring overheating issues can lead to cylinder damage or complete system breakdown. Addressing these issues promptly keeps your truck operational and reduces major expenses. Stay alert for warning signs to guarantee your diesel truck's reliability.

Comparing On-Location and Shop-Based Diesel Services
If your diesel equipment or fleet faces unexpected breakdowns, choosing between on-site and in-shop repair services becomes a critical decision affecting downtime and operational efficiency. On-site diesel repair brings the technician straight to your site, reducing towing needs and cutting down time off the road. This solution is perfect for minor repairs, quick engine diagnostics, and immediate troubleshooting—supporting optimal fuel efficiency. However, complicated problems like major system repairs or sophisticated testing could necessitate specialized equipment accessible solely at service centers.
Professional diesel repair facilities offer a dedicated workspace equipped with specialized equipment, extensive parts availability, and professional lifts. Should your equipment demand thorough inspection or intricate repairs, bringing it to a facility guarantees precision and meticulousness. Consider the problem's complexity and your operational needs prior to making a choice.

Essential Preventive Maintenance Tips to Minimize Emergency Breakdowns
Setting up a systematic preventive maintenance program substantially reduces the risk of abrupt diesel engine malfunctions. Begin by planning regular checks of your engine's fluid and filtration components, as these elements play a crucial role in optimal fuel efficiency. Check fuel lines for wear and tear to eliminate sudden performance issues. Tire maintenance is also vital; check tire pressure and tread depth regularly to ensure safe handling and stop blowouts. Maintain your tires according to manufacturer recommendations to extend their lifespan and maintain even wear. Pay attention to battery terminals—clean and tighten connections to avoid electrical malfunctions. Resolve minor issues immediately, get more info as unattended concerns can escalate into costly emergency breakdowns. Ongoing, meticulous care ensures your vehicle performing consistently on the road.
